Introduction: The COVID-19 crisis has disrupted industries and economies worldwide, challenging businesses to rethink their strategies and pivot for survival. However, resilient businesses have gone beyond mere survival and embarked on a transformative journey. This article delves into the ongoing pivot journey of resilient businesses, exploring how they have turned crisis into opportunity and embraced transformation for long-term success.

  1. Embracing Change as a Catalyst: Resilient businesses understand that change is not just inevitable but can also be a catalyst for growth. They proactively seek out opportunities in the face of crisis, recognizing that transformation is essential for staying relevant in a rapidly evolving landscape. By embracing change, these businesses position themselves as leaders in their industries and foster a culture of continuous adaptation.
  2. Agility and Flexibility: Pivoting requires agility and flexibility. Resilient businesses have agile decision-making processes, allowing them to quickly respond to market shifts and emerging trends. They remain open to new ideas, encourage experimentation, and adapt their strategies based on real-time feedback. By being nimble and flexible, these businesses can seize emerging opportunities and mitigate risks effectively.
  3. Customer-Centric Transformation: Resilient businesses prioritize understanding their customers’ evolving needs and preferences. They leverage customer insights and market research to drive transformative changes in their products, services, and customer experiences. By putting the customer at the center of their pivot journey, these businesses build stronger relationships, enhance customer loyalty, and differentiate themselves in the market.
  4. Innovation and Creativity: To drive transformation, resilient businesses foster a culture of innovation and creativity. They encourage employees to think outside the box, explore new ideas, and challenge conventional wisdom. By nurturing an environment that values innovation, these businesses can develop unique solutions, create new revenue streams, and adapt to changing market dynamics.
  5. Strategic Partnerships and Collaborations: Resilient businesses recognize the power of strategic partnerships and collaborations. They actively seek out alliances with like-minded organizations, technology providers, and industry experts to access new markets, share resources, and co-create innovative solutions. These partnerships enable businesses to leverage complementary strengths, accelerate transformation, and achieve mutual growth.
  6. Digital Transformation: Digital transformation is a key enabler for resilient businesses. They embrace technology to streamline operations, enhance efficiency, and create new business models. By leveraging emerging technologies such as cloud computing, data analytics, artificial intelligence, and automation, these businesses gain a competitive edge and create seamless digital experiences for their customers.
  7. Continuous Learning and Adaptation: Resilient businesses prioritize continuous learning and adaptation. They invest in employee development, upskilling, and reskilling initiatives to foster a culture of learning. By encouraging employees to embrace change, learn new skills, and adapt to evolving market demands, these businesses remain agile and stay ahead of the curve.

Conclusion: Resilient businesses understand that crisis is not the end, but rather an opportunity for transformation. By embracing change, prioritizing customer-centricity, fostering agility and flexibility, driving innovation, forging strategic partnerships, embracing digital transformation, and nurturing a culture of continuous learning and adaptation, these businesses embark on an ongoing pivot journey. Through their transformative efforts, they not only survive but thrive in a rapidly changing business landscape.
